Should you use a Mist filter for your portrait photography? During this portrait photoshoot, I take side by side photos using a Pro-Mist Filter vs not using a filter. I organised this portrait session with Wiktoria while I was travelling through Poznan, Poland in the summer. I am using the Sony A7IV with the GM 35mm f1.4 lens for the first half of our photoshoot. Afterwards, I switch to the GM 85mm f1.4 to capture the rest of our portraits. The filter I decided to use is the Tiffen Black Pro-Mist 1/4 strength filter.
